@charset "utf-8";
/* CSS Document */

a:hover {
	color: #000000;
}

#form
{
 width: 300px; 
 height: auto;
 /* backgroud-image: url(aquí la ruta de la imagen de fondo); */
 margin: 0 auto;
 box-shadow: 5px 5px 0 #AAA;
 border-radius: 5px;
 line-height: 1
}


#form h2
{
    color:#27748A;
    font-size:25px;
    margin:0;
}

#form p
{
    font-size:14px;
    color:#222222;
}
#form div
{
    margin-top:1px;
}

#form input
{
    border:2px solid #9ECEDB;
    padding:3px 5px;
}

.montos
{
    width:50px;
    font-size:12px;
}

.anhos
{
    width:12px;
    font-size:12px;
}

.num
{
    width:20px;
    font-size:12px;    
}

.textos
{
    width:80%;
    font-size:12px;       
}

.dominio
{
    width:150px;
    font-size:12px;
}

.fecha
{
    width:100px;
    font-size:12px;       
}

#form label
{
    font-weight:bold;
    font-size:12px;
    color:#184552;
}

#form button
{
    background-color: #9ECEDB;
    color: #184552;
    cursor:pointer;
}

#form button:hover
{
    background-color: #CBEAF2;
}

.required
{
    color:#dd6666;
}

.marco {
   width: 240px;
}

.mini {
   width: 50px;
}